Parikia is a good place to begin your travels of Paros. it...
Parikia is a good place to begin your travels of Paros. it is a convenient location to base yourself in as there is a bus terminal that allows you to take a short ride to Naoussa and surrounding areas. Overall, we preffered the small village of Aliki for a longer stay, as it was quiter and had a more relaxing vibe. The beaches in Parikia were not overly special, and I would not advise staying here if you desire luxury scenery. If you wish to visit the nicer beaches, definitely hire an ATV. Overall, Parikia itself has affordable food and accomodation options.

Rent a car in advance because there are 30 taxis on the...
Rent a car in advance because there are 30 taxis on the island. The bus worked well, however, they had a schedule that sometimes did not work for everybody. Restaurants in Parikia are not all not good and it depends on what are you looking for.
